Fully unmanned, Robotaxi takes a key step in commercial closed loop

Robotaxi has moved from a closed test field to an open road manned test, and then to today's fully driverless landing. Apollo has completed a brand-new technological leap in 7 years. At this point, Robotaxi has finally outlined a complete commercial closed loop.

Apollo leads the way, but at the same time it also raises a question. To realize fully autonomous driving, what front-end capabilities are needed?

In Baidu World 2020, Li Zhenyu responded with the three elements of "pre-installed mass-produced car", "veteran AI driver" and "5G cloud driving".

"Front-loaded mass-produced vehicles" are literally understood, they are customized models produced by OEMs that can be copied and mass-produced on a large scale. Compared with modified self-driving vehicles, front-mounted mass-produced vehicles greatly ensure the Consistency and safety and stability.

At present, Baidu's leading pre-installed mass-produced vehicle, the Hongqi EV Robotaxi, which will roll off the assembly line in 2019, has already run in Beijing, Changsha, Guangzhou, Chongqing, and Cangzhou, and has started fully autonomous driving tests in some areas.

"Ai veteran driver" refers to the complete unmanned driving capability, which is what we often call hard power.

For old human drivers, we measure two standards, namely, driving experience and accident rate. Although Apollo’s “AI veteran driver” has only 7 years of driving experience, the overall test mileage exceeds 6 million kilometers, and the accident rate has always remained zero. From this perspective, Apollo’s “AI veteran driver” has an older safe driving experience than humans. Drivers have to be richer.

Baidu believes that after a cumulative total of 100,000 passengers in 27 cities around the world, the "veteran AI driver" is smart enough to solve most of the problems, and the remaining few extreme and special edge scenarios will be driven by "5G cloud." To solve.

"5G Cloud Driving" is an important supporting service for unmanned driving. Based on 5G, smart transportation, V2X and other new infrastructure facilities, "5G Cloud Driving" is autonomous driving when autonomous vehicles face road changes or traffic control. System fills up. The "5G cloud driving" that received the request will take over the driverless car and change it to a parallel driving state to help the car solve problems.

Since "veteran AI drivers" can handle most road conditions, extreme scenarios do not appear frequently, so unlike ordinary safety officers, a cloud driver can serve many vehicles alone.

Combining these three elements to form a whole, self-driving vehicles have the possibility of large-scale deployment. Self-driving vehicles are about to enter the era of parallel driving and will give birth to a new business model of self-driving car sharing.

In addition to Robotaxi, Apollo's small-scale vehicle, autonomous parking solutions, and ACE traffic engine have also achieved large-scale landing leadership in their respective fields.

According to data released by Baidu, in the first half of this year, Xiaodu Cars has cooperated with 60+ mainstream auto brands around the world, with more than 500 models on the market. According to the "China Intelligent Connected Market Trend Report" recently released by IHS Markit In 2020, Xiaodu's vehicle capacity has already ranked first in the world in the field of intelligent networked vehicles.

In the direction of intelligent transportation, Apollo's "ACE transportation engine" has landed in nearly 20 cities across the country, which has greatly improved travel efficiency and has become the number one player in the new infrastructure of intelligent transportation.

In addition, the new Weimar model equipped with Baidu's Apollo autonomous parking solution will go on sale early next year. This will be China's first model equipped with L4 autonomous parking. It can find parking spaces in multi-storey basement, one-click valet parking and call.

Baidu Apollo has achieved rapid replication and customization in the three fields of intelligent transportation, intelligent vehicle linkage and autonomous driving.

In terms of intelligent transportation, Baidu Apollo released the "ACE traffic engine". Through the overall architecture of "1+2+N", it can be like building blocks to combine required functional modules and extended functional applications under the same digital base. .

In terms of smart car connectivity, Baidu Apollo provides a wealth of optional solutions for car companies and individual users from the front to the back of the car through three embedded smart cockpits, CarLife+, and a small mirror. It can attract consumers in a short period of time through after-installation, or deep customization of smart car-linked products through front-installation.

In terms of autonomous driving, Baidu Apollo allows partners to develop autonomous driving products in a short period of time by opening up the autonomous driving kit, and allows more developers to enter multiple special scenarios, such as the Yimin open-pit mine. The driverless mining developed by the Apollo system is now available.

At the Baidu World 2020 Autonomous Driving Sub-forum, Baidu released the latest version of its open platform, Apollo 6.0, as scheduled, open sourced its safe and unmanned capabilities, and added multiple cloud services to make it easier for developers to use. Today, the Apollo open platform has open sourced 600,000 lines of code, gathered 45,000 developers and 210 ecological partners around the world, and a win-win ecosystem with Apollo as the center of the entire industrial chain is growing infinitely.
